Subtronics Is Readying His First Full-Length Album

Since starting his own record label and putting out a few EP’s, Subtronics has been working on his first full-length album.

Subtronics announced on Twitter that for the past few months, he has been working on his first full-length album. Earlier this year, Subtronics started his very own record label, Cyclops Recordings, which features three different sub-genres of electronic dance music. He also released his ‘String Theory’ EP which featured Wooli and Kompany. Subtronics is known for production diversity and capability; his ‘Wooked on Tronics’ performance alias shows just how far he can push the boundaries of his tracks, although, we’re sure there are more boundaries to be reached. We’re extremely excited to hear what Subtronics has in store for us on his first full-length album, we’ll let you know once we know more!
